Details of input signals
The following shows the input signals of BACnet modules for a CPU module.
Module READY (X0)
This signal turns ON when turning the power OFF and ON, or resetting a CPU module, or a BACnet module is ready. It turns
OFF when the module does not operate due to an error, such as a watchdog timer error.
Initialization complete/operation stop or restart (X1)
CheckYDevice in the BACnet detail setting is '0'
This signal turns ON when a BACnet module is started and initialization is complete. After the initialization is complete, the
buffer memory can be accessed and the functions of BACnet modules are available.
It turns OFF when the BACnet module is started but initialization is yet to complete.
CheckYDevice in the BACnet detail setting is '1'
This signal turns ON when "Joining of BACnet" (Y1) is turned ON.
This signal turns OFF by clicking the [Pause] button on the "Pause/Restart" screen displayed by selecting [Maintenance]
[Pause/Restart] in a configuration function. In that case, turn "Joining of BACnet" (Y1) OFF.
Set the CheckYDevice in [Settings] [Basic Information] [BACnet Detail Setting] button "Interface". (Page 281
Interface)
BACnet status (join/leave) (X2)
This signal turns ON when a BACnet module has joined BACnet. (The value of the SystemStatus property of a Device object
in a BACnet module is Operational.)
It turns OFF when a BACnet module has left the BACnet. (The value of the SystemStatus property of a Device object in a
BACnet module is other than Operational.)
For the value of the SystemStatus property, refer to the address (Un\G16) described in the following section.
Page 261 Device object (Un\G16 to Un\G31)
Buffer memory access (X3)
This signal turns ON while a BACnet module performs cyclic reading of the buffer memory.
This signal turns OFF when the cycle reading is not performed.
For the cyclic reading, refer to the following section.
Page 264 Loading buffer memory
Time synchronization send complete (X5)
This signal turns ON when 'Time synchronization send request' (Y5) is turned ON and the sending of a TimeSynchronization
service or an UTC TimeSynchronization service is complete.
It turns OFF when a TimeSynchronization service or an UTC TimeSynchronization service is not sent or 'Time synchronization
send request' (Y5) is turned ON and OFF.
Who-Is send complete (X6)
This signal turns ON when a 'Who-Is send request' (Y6) is turned ON and the sending of a Who-Is service is complete.
It turns OFF when a Who-Is service is not sent, or 'Who-Is send request' (Y6) is turned ON and OFF.
Error occurrence (XF)
This signal turns ON when an error occurred on a BACnet module or on the network controlled by a BACnet module.
When this signal turned ON, the ALM LED turns ON.
It turns OFF when no error occurred on a BACnet module or on the network controlled by a BACnet module.
